US Air Force Refueling Plane Crashes in Western Iraq

Summary

A US Air Force KC-135 Stratotanker refueling aircraft crashed in western Iraq, with no attack involved. Rescue operations are ongoing.

Key Points
  • A US Air Force KC-135 Stratotanker refueling aircraft crashed in western Iraq.
  • Two aircraft were involved; the second aircraft landed safely.
  • The crash was confirmed not to be caused by attack or friendly fire.
  • Rescue operations intensified at the crash site, but crew details remain unreleased.
